Elektra Natchios is a Marvel Comics anti-hero created by Frank Miller. Making her debut in Daredevil #168 (January, 1981) as Matt Murdock's college love interest turned assassin, Elektra is one of Daredevil's most dangerous, unpredictable enemies. Originally a college student at New York's Columbia University with her boyfriend, Matt Murdock, the Greek-born Elektra left for Japan after the accidental death of her father. Encountering Stick, leader of the secret martial arts organization known as the Chaste, Elektra's fighting skills were honed to peak human levels. Unfortunately the hate in her heart got her expelled from the Chaste, so Elektra joined their rivals, the Hand. Corrupted by the Hand, Elektra became the organization's top assassin until breaking free from their control and returning to New York.

After the Man Without Fear saves her from mobster Eric Slaughter and his hit men, Elektra learns Daredevil's secret identity and tries to rekindle their relationship only to be rejected because of her killing ways. Together, the former lovers battle and defeat the Hand after the organization attempts to kill members of the Chaste. After Elektra became the Kingpin's chief assassin, Elektra and Daredevil battle continuously until she was ordered to kill Franklin "Foggy" Nelson, Matt Murdock's best friend. Unable to kill Foggy, who recognized her as "Matt's girl", Elektra was forced to battle Bullseye, the Kingpin's former chief assassin. Elektra fought hard but was defeated by Bullseye after he impaled her on her own sai. Mortally wounded, Elektra crawled to Matt's doorstep and died in his arms. Resurrected thanks to Daredevil and Stone, an associate of Stick, Elektra traveled the world as a freelance assassin/bounty hunter. After aiding SHIELD, Wolverine, and her former lover Daredevil, Electra was replaced by a Skrull agent named Siri prior to the Secret Invasion event.
